RFI This is a Presolicitation, Request for Information (RFI). This is GSA's first outreach intended to engage industry and identify small business concerns that can provide Identity, Credential, and Access Management (ICAM) support services. The Identity, Credential, Access Management (ICAM) Division of the General Services Administration (GSA) is interested in obtaining information technology (IT) and program management office (PMO) support services for its ICAM Program. GSA is considering conducting an acquisition for ICAM support services as a small business set-aside, but lacks information as to whether there are sufficient small business vendors who can provide these particular services. As defined in the Federal Identity, Credential, Access Management Roadmap and Guidance, ICAM services in the federal environment include: Personal Identity Verification (PIV) card issuance and maintenance; provisioning, authentication and authorization services for accessing IT applications and federal buildings; maintenance of and access to a shared registry that is an authoritative source for agency staff information; and services for the use of digital signatures and the federal Public Key Infrastructure (PKI). PIV card issuance and maintenance services were authorized in 2004 under Homeland Security Presidential Directive 12 (HSPD-12) for use with accessing federal IT systems and facilities and are also known as HSPD-12 credentialing services.
